You can make Old Bay steamed shrimp with either fresh or frozen shrimp. Frozen shrimp will need to be thawed in cold water for 5 minutes. Then you’ll need to peel and devein the shrimp.

Cajun gumbo

Whether you want to eat a bowl of gumbo as a quick meal or plan a special occasion, gumbo is a satisfying and hearty dish. You can serve it with various vegetables and spices and do it over a bowl of cooked rice.

The key to making delicious gumbo is making a roux. This is a mixture of equal parts flour and fat, such as butter. A good roux adds a depth of flavor and a smoky flavor to gumbo. You can prepare a roux and store it in the refrigerator for up to three days.
